Is off-road rollerblading traditionally made up of several skating technical maneuvers
Are you asking how many gliding techniques are traditionally used in cross-country rollerblading?3.
Two-step alternating glide: a cyclical gliding technique in which the athlete's feet and hands each make two strokes and stick movements.
Simultaneous propulsion glide: on the basis of the stable glide of the two boards, the use of the combined force of the upper body downward pressure and the two poles backward push, to propel the body forward glide technical action.
Stepping forward at the same time: a commonly used technique in cross-country rollerblading, in the process of skating, both feet at the same time to force the ground, so that the rollerblade skating forward action.
